M Elle
This has got to be my new favorite restaurant. It is so delicious and everything we got literally melted in our mouths. japanese and italian inspired cuisine/fusion?! how unique and two of my favorite cuisines. the flavors were all there. My friend and I loved the hamachi collar – best and crispiest fish we have ever had. We absolutely LOVED the uni toast. the buttery toast with uni on top was so freaking good. i have never tasted anything so delicious. it was savory and sweet. the tuna tartare was 10/10 best tuna tartare i’ve ever had and the tuna tasted so fresh. you get to DIY yourself and top it off with seaweed snacks. the soy butter bigoli pasta was a mixture of asian and italian. their cocktails were also delicious and unique. it is quite expensive BUT it is so worth it. i can’t wait to come back and try the other things i didn’t get to try. the seared scallop topped with prosciutto was sooo yummy. most fresh scallops i’ve had and it was cooked perfectly. for dessert, we got the bombolocini which was a mochi ball and inside had nutella fillings. it tasted exactly like a ferrero rocher but in a kochi version.

Michael Davis
I think about this place. Japanese and Italian? What a combo. Make sure to get reservations. Both inside and outside dining is nice. Great options for alcoholic and non alcoholic drinks. I’ve gone here twice with two different people. I wish I could say try X but their menu is seasonal. Make sure to always get a pasta dish. Didn’t try a pizza yet but maybe that’s next. Last time I went I didn’t love the branzino since it felt kinda boring compared to all the other dishes but I really loved the seasonal corn dish I had in August. What I can tell you though is the dessert is out of this world, specifically the Yakult soft serve. Obviously it’s seasonal so the flavor can differ but don’t get weirded out by the fish skin. It really was a game changer for me. Wish they had the rice cake lasagna year around.
